Output ed82b93740751ada6aa0581b0a4170088fda25ec8ea05a27db9df144ffe667c7:15

value
13661717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1727a6a58f1776b81f050531e9b948f9d6ce3b52 OP_EQUAL
address
33oSxxEXBuoHFvRVGdmfqFzCkdTqpRN5n5
transaction
ed82b93740751ada6aa0581b0a4170088fda25ec8ea05a27db9df144ffe667c7
spent
true